The Barbarian Iron Road, usually shortened to BIR, is railway company that is wholly owned by the Barbarian Republic, it is the sole passenger railway operator in Barbary. The BIR operates a regular service between Basella and Naval with diesel locomotives, and a service between Basella and Nova Victoria via Yixing with steam locomotives. The latter is highly dangerous as most of the route goes through the Green and is often targeted by bandit ambushes.
